We head to a new exhibit in Holyoke that’s helping newer artists explore their craft, and the anniversary of this nation with more experienced artists in the area. Valley Arts Mentors branched out of Piti Theater, but has grown to encompass many ways that we all tell stories including visual arts. This year’s cohort of mentors and mentees have recently opened an exhibit Revolutionary Artstories: Life, Liberty and the Pursuit of Equity, which we explore along with the artists who’ve made the work on display.
The Green River Festival happened this past weekend, but if you think about festivals you've been to, how are their lineups looking in terms of gender diversity? Book More Women is an upcoming soon to be non-profit that started as an instagram project and has evolved into a full on movement, in which the Green River festival has partnered. We speak with founder Abbey Carbonneau about starting the organization, what her data has shown so far, and the struggles of getting other organizations to recognize their blind spots.
Plus after running around all weekend we get to talk a little bit about our highlights from the festival as well.
